      <description>&lt;P&gt;I've come across the following scenario.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;User 1 shares a folder with user 2&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;User 2 moves this share folder in to a private folder.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;User 1 deletes this folder from his dropbox. It appears to still retain the permissions and still available in user 2s dropbox.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;It still shows as user 1 being the owner. in users 2s dropbox. I had not prompt to unshare it before deleting. Is this how it should be?&lt;/P&gt;

      <description>&lt;P&gt;&lt;EM&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;Is this how it should be?&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;/EM&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;Yes, by deleting the folder without un-sharing it first, you basically removed yourself from it and left it available for everyone else. To remove a shared folder from other users you need to either kick them out of it or un-share it.&lt;/P&gt;
